Eward L. Bernays Papers. Sketches for two Note Cards.

Two approximately 3.5-by-5-inch, hand-drawn, holiday note cards, in pencil. They depict public-relations counsel Edward Bernays's frenetic life as the organizer of multimedia promotional spectacles. One, a Christmas card, portrays Bernays as a juggler standing on what appears to be a moving platform, using his arms, feet, and mouth (pictured as a broadcast megaphone) to balance trains, boats, airplanes, trucks, and telephones. A second card features Bernays as a magician who with his wand is causing trains to run, boats to sail, radios to broadcast, airplanes to fly, and telephones to ring off the hook.
